I love reading anthologies and mystery stories are the best. These are old English mysteries and they have their own flavor. I enjoy them.
Poisoned Pen Press and Edelweiss let me read this book for review (thank you). It will be published October 1st.
These are not sweet stories. Even with a policeman at the gathering, death happens. Christmas is not always a happy event when there are family problems. Most of the time it does not end in death but these characters are too far gone in their hatred or quest for revenge to care.
My favorite is about a bookseller who robs on the side. He dresses himself and his accomplices in Santa outfits to go to the department store to steal the jewels. They fit in but the robbery doesn't go down easily. One is taken into custody right off the bat. He was to set off a fire bomb, which he did. But he was seen. Then another man was seen by the boss and that turns into a shootout with another member of the team going down. The mastermind escapes with the jewels and he's confident he's safe. But one little thing has given him away...
Many of the stories are ironic. As they say, crime doesn't pay. These stories show you why.
